Margaret Niche

    Margaret Niche is a Senior Director and the Global Head of Operational Management within ICE Data Services, a division of Intercontinental Exchange (ICE). In her role, Niche oversees product operations for the Connectivity & Feeds group. This encompasses the full suite of connectivity and data services, including the Secure Financial Transaction Infrastructure (SFTI®) products and wireless offerings, as well as aggregated data and content from over 600 sources worldwide. Previously, Niche was the Chief Administrative Officer for NYSE Technologies Connectivity, a division of the New York Stock Exchange that served as the entrepreneurial technology arm of the NYSE, until the NYSE was acquired by ICE in 2014. Niche joined the NYSE by way of its acquisition of NYFIX, Inc., a company whose network enabled users to electronically communicate trade data among the buy-side, sell-side and exchange floor environments. Prior to joining NYFIX, Niche also served in various positions at RSL Communications, GTE Corporation and Contel Communications, all firms in the telecommunications industry. Niche began her career at Arthur Andersen LLP, where she was an Audit Manager specializing in the Electric, Gas and Telecommunications industry groups. Niche holds a Bachelor of Science in Accounting from New York University and is a Certified Public Accountant.
